Distribution: the act of providing copies (either by fax or direct mailing) of transcribed reports to providers, consultants, or other healthcare professionals as indicated by the dictating physician. Draft: an initial version of a transcribed report that has not been signed by the provider. WebMar 25, 2024 · The core process of dictation is:- A physician or a healthcare professional dictates into a device, that audio is sent to a transcriptionist who then types it into a document.
